Teach in a shala surrounded by nature
The yoga shala is private, quiet, and exclusively yours during your stay. Natural light filters through the palm trees throughout the day, creating a calm atmosphere for practice. Mats, blocks, straps, and bolsters are already provided, so there is nothing to transport or arrange.
Stay comfortably in the cottages
The property can host up to 20 guests across 10 cottages. There are five spacious king-bed suites for couples or anyone wanting extra room, and five twin cottages ideal for friends sharing the experience. Each room is large, fitted with mosquito nets, and includes a modern bathroom with hot water and a private terrace overlooking the palm garden. The cottages surround the yoga shala, helping the group stay connected and close together.
Dining and spa experiences
Your package includes daily brunch in the Riverside Restaurant, with fresh chai, tea, coffee, and nourishing vegetarian dishes made with local fruit and vegetables. Vegan, gluten-free, and other dietary needs can be accommodated with care. Fresh juice and tropical fruit are also served before afternoon sessions or as needed. Group evening buffets can be arranged on request, offering satisfying vegetarian meals for full days of practice.
Guests can also enjoy authentic Ayurvedic spa treatments on site. Options include Abhyanga massage, Shirodhara, and rejuvenating body polishes. Treatments are scheduled around your yoga sessions, and you and your guests receive 10% off all spa treatments.

Planning details
Palm Trees Yoga Resort is available for bookings from October through April, when Goa enjoys its dry season, comfortable temperatures, and plenty of sunshine. We recommend booking 6–12 months in advance, especially for the peak season from December to February. A deposit is required to secure your dates, with the balance due 30 days before arrival.

Set in the original heart of the Palm Trees area, these traditional Keralan eco-cottages offer an authentic stay surrounded by lush greenery and natural calm. Built from coconut wood, mud blocks, and palm leaves, they are thoughtfully designed to blend into the landscape rather than stand apart from it. A peaceful river runs alongside the cottages, adding to the sense of quiet and connection with nature.
Each cottage includes a private terrace with views over the palm garden, creating a lovely spot to rest, read, or simply enjoy the stillness. Inside, guests will find mosquito nets and fans, with air conditioning available for extra comfort.
